I have done only partial hospitalization, which is the step below inpatient. It's where you stay at the hospital during the day but you're allowed to go home to sleep. It offers similarly intensive treatment but for patients who are safe to be left unattended. (Inpatient was recommended to me, but not required because I was not considered a danger to myself or others )
